>On 12/16/2013 3:20 PM, mike wrote:
[]
>> I would not just plug in a SSD.
>> At the very least, turn off the last access update. It's called -noatime
>> in linux. Don't remember the term for windows.
>>
>> Too much hype for too little performance/price ratio for me.
>
>Oh man! I use both SSDs and classic mechanical hard drives. And I have 
>been using SSDs really heavy since 2008. Thus IMHO, the fear of wearing 
>them out is so overrated. For most people, I don't think you will wear 
>the average one out in about 70 years plus. If you get 30 years out of 
>your average mechanical hard drive, you are doing great. But I don't 
>think most would care after 10 years anyway since new drives will 
>always be so much larger and faster and cheaper anyway.
>
There is still the matter that failure, when it comes, is more likely to 
be sudden and total for an SSD than for a rotating drive. (S&T failure 
does of course occur for the latter, but isn't the normal mode of 
failure.)
